Ms. Finn has outdone herself with this book. The short stories are fast paced and well plotted with interesting characters. Surprisingly, this isn't just a bit of fluff body-swap TG fiction. There is a plot thread of “Dark Justice” that runs through all of the stories tying them together and giving the book a more sophisticated feeling than I was expecting.

You'll find yourself rooting for Titus to stop the traitorous Herminius in “Seduction.” Then in “Princess and the Slave” justice arrives with a surprising twist. The perils of magic and seeking power cannot be better illustrated than in “To be the Khan.” “Whispering Death” brings the macabre to life as the dark power of the “Hawk” is unleashed. In “The Master Race” a Nazi gets a richly deserved reward and the next story, “Dotage,” is set up. Lastly “Dotage” ties it all together and leaves the reader wanting to know what happens next.

All-in-all this book was well worth reading. If you’re a fan of TG fiction with a dark twist you will enjoy this book.
